Giving medal to whoever helps? Using complete sentences, explain how to find the average rate of change for f(x) from x = 4 to x = 7.

In order to find the average rate of change of a function from x=4 to x=7, you plug in x=7 into f(x) and subtract it by x=4 into f(x). Then you would divide it by the interval difference which 7-4=3. Here is the formula:\[\frac{ f(7)-f(4) }{ 7-4 }\]
